Getting this up tonight since we've got us a game between Houston and Tulane! I've only got one notable guy from each team worth watching last night but let me know if there are other guys on the teams you think are worth looking at.

For Tulane it's Patrick Johnson, EDGE, #7. I've heard his name a couple of times as a G5 mid-round upside kind of guy. Haven't watched him at all yet but I looked him up and he's got 4 sacks through three games with one of those games being Navy. So basically 4 sacks in two games. Not too bad. Interested to see what he's all about.

For Houston it's their first game of the season with their first 4? game I think being cancelled. The guy I've got for them is Marquez Stevenson, WR, #5. He's supposed to be an incredibly fast player so I'm interested to see what else he brings to the table beyond that.

Games I'm looking forward to tomorrow

For the noon games I'm mostly going to be watching the Florida-Texas A&M game. I don't think I'll ever get tired of watching Kyle Pitts, dude is just too good. Plus I haven't paid a ton of attention to Tony and Grimes so I want to keep an eye out for them as well. Florida has a couple of decent mid-round type guys in the secondary so I want to see how Mond does against them as well. Finally, I've been hearing some good things about A&M EDGE guy Michael Clemons so I want to watch him as well. I might pop over to the Virginia Tech-UNC game on commericals and such to check out those UNC WRs Newsome and Brown. Also heard a new name for Virginia Tech in Christian Darrisow, OT. So I might check him out as well if VTech is on offense.

For the afternoon games, there's not a ton prospect wise so I'll probably be checking out Tennessee-Georgia. I've heard the name Josh Palmer a couple of times this week as a guy to watch as a mid-round sleeper (@Ragnarok, is he any good?). He's a Tennessee WR so we'll see how he matches up against a good Georgia secondary. Also the obvious other names like Trey Smith and Zamir White for their teams.

For the evening games the big matchup is obviously Clemson-Miami. I'd like to see how Jackson Carman does against the Miami pass rushers Roche and Philips, who have both looked good so far. I also was watching some tape for another guy and Derion Kendrick popped out a couple of times so I'd like to do a more dedicated watch on him this game as well. Might pop over to the Notre Dame-Florida State game on commercials to try to check out Jeremiah Owusu-Koramoah.

I think I'm done watching Pitts, I've seen enough. Dude is a fringe top 10 guy. The only thing holding him back is his position. So damn good. This TD catch he just had where the A&M defender was literally throwing him to the ground as he caught it? Incredible. He's strong, athletic, versatile. Great player.
